Vulcan\UserDocs\Extensions\PageControllerExtension
Class PageControllerExtension
Synopsis
class PageControllerExtension
extends Extension
{
- // members
- private array $anchors = ;
- // methods
- public bool IsUserDocsPage()
- public bool|ArrayList generateUserDocsBreadcrumb()
- public DBHTMLText|bool UserDocsBreadcrumb()
- public DBHTMLText|bool UserDocsContents()
- public string getAnchoredContent()
- public string generateAnchorSlug()
- public bool isValidAnchorSlug()
Hierarchy
Extends
- SilverStripe\Core\Extension
Members
private
- $anchors — array
Methods
public
- IsUserDocsPage() — Helper to determine if the current page is apart of this module
- UserDocsBreadcrumb()
- UserDocsContents() — Render the contents of this category. You should always append ".RAW" when using this method in a template e.g $RenderContents.RAW
- generateAnchorSlug()
- generateUserDocsBreadcrumb()
- getAnchoredContent()
- isValidAnchorSlug()